the atomic theory has changed several times over the past 200 years as new evidence was discovered. what does this reveal about scientific knowledge?
theories improve and change as new evidence becomes available
theories constantly change because scientists cannot agree
scientific theories are permanently fixed once accepted
scientific laws replace theories when they are proven true.
Scientific knowledge evolves. Theories are not static; they improve and change as new evidence emerges, which is why the atomic theory has changed over the past 200 years.
